House Roll Call 282, 106th Congress · July 14, 1999

H R 2466 AUTHOR(S): SANDERS OF VERMONT AMENDMENT QUESTION: ON AGREEING TO THE AMENDMENT DEPARTMENT OF THE INTERIOR AND RELATED AGENCIES APPROPRIATIONS ACT, 2000

Question before the chamber: On Agreeing to the Amendment

243 yea · 180 nayAgreed to12 not voting or present
Democrat186 yea · 14 nay
Republican56 yea · 166 nay
Independent1 yea · 0 nay
